Host data exfiltration via embedded pre-startup loader
Published Oct 8, 2025 · Updated Oct 8, 2025
Embedded malicious code in CCleaner 5.33.6162 and CCleaner Cloud 1.07.3191 allows attackers to exfiltrate Windows host data. A modified startup callback invokes a custom loader that decrypts an embedded blob, creates executable heap memory, and runs an in-memory payload that profiles the host and posts encoded telemetry to hard-coded or DGA-derived C2 infrastructure. Execution requires a 32-bit Windows installation and an active launch by an administrator; the payload can also run C2-supplied shellcode, while macOS and 64-bit builds are unaffected.
